What Is Sober Living? Sober living environments serve as essential stepping stones for individuals looking to re-establish their independence after addiction treatment. They are structured yet supportive homes where residents prioritize sobriety and personal growth. Unlike inpatient rehab centers, sober living homes do not provide clinical treatment but instead offer a stable atmosphere, daily expectations, and mutual accountability. For those searching for accessible programs like sober living in Boulder, Colorado, this environment offers practical life skills and reinforces positive change. What Is Substance Use Disorder? Substance use disorder (SUD) is a complex medical condition that profoundly affects both mental and physical health. Those struggling with SUD are often unable to control their use of drugs or alcohol, despite facing negative consequences at work, at home, or in their relationships. The cravings and compulsions that come with this condition can be all-consuming, making it incredibly challenging for individuals to stop using on their own.
